实用云,提供最全最实时的云市场资讯

手机站:/m

网站服务器_lol连接不到服务器_返现

时间:2021-09-28 10:01编辑:实用云来源:实用云当前位置:主页 > 云通信 >

网站服务器_lol连接不到服务器_返现

在最近的一次讨论中,前成员向我指出了一些在我头脑中不清楚的东西,淘客推广怎么做,因此在文档中也没有明确说明(尽管人们可能会以这样或那样的方式推断出来)。

这是关于RFC会话的登录语言是如何设置的。

首先是一些术语的澄清:

登录语言是在as ABAP上打开用户会话时用作登录参数。会话期间无法更改用户会话的登录语言。您可以使用类CL\u ABAP\u system的方法get\u LOGON\u LANGUAGE来获取它。

内部会话,即执行ABAP程序的用户会话中的会话,海淘客,大数据与云计算,万云,具有由语言控制的文本环境。文本环境影响诸如内部表的文本排序之类的事情。文本环境的语言可以在sy langu中找到,您可以从类CL\u ABAP\u SYST的方法get\u language获得。启动内部会话时,文本环境的语言是登录语言。但是您可以使用SET LOCALE language更改文本环境的语言。在这个语句之后,文本环境的语言和sy language可以与登录语言不同。文本环境的语言更改仅在当前内部会话中有效。调用另一个程序会再次启动一个使用登录语言的新的内部会话。

RFC会话是一个完全成熟的用户会话,当通过RFC接口调用RFM(远程功能模块)时会打开该会话。RFC会话的登录参数要么在SM59中为RFC目标定义,要么隐式传递。后者尤其适用于预定义的目的地NONE,因此也适用于调用函数在不指定目的地的情况下启动新任务。

如何设置RFC会话的登录参数,这些参数在目的地中没有定义?

RFC会话的用户名是主叫会话的用户名(sy uname)

RFC会话的客户端是主叫会话的客户端(sy mandt)

RFC会话的登录语言是主叫会话的文本环境语言(sy langu)

换言之,RFC会话的登录语言不一定是调用会话的登录语言(sy langu不一定是登录语言)!您可以在调用会话中使用SET LOCALE LANGUAGE来影响RFC会话的登录语言。

功能模块正在一个完全成熟的用户会话中运行,登录语言为"E"。依赖于登录语言的一切,例如表面文本、文本池、格式,当然还有文本环境,都会受到调用者文本环境语言的影响。

例如,如果RFM如下所示:

RFC以英语打开SE38,独立于调用者的登录语言。请注意,将SET LOCALE LANGUAGE直接放在CALL事务前面不会起作用,因为调用将打开一个新的内部会话。

当然,您可以在RFM中再次使用SET LOCALE LANGUAGE,以便在那里设置内部会话的文本环境。

PS:提醒,不要将SET LOCALE LANGUAGE与SET LANGUAGE混淆。后者不设置语言,而是加载给定语言的文本池

,云实

上一篇中间件_伪物语百度云_稳定性好

下一篇域名交易_七牛cdn免备案_学生机

世界之最排行

世界之最精选